I've used it on my 3 at times. It has a bit better effect on ticks than some of the other spot treatments. Usually works within 24 hours if ticks are already embedded and it's fairly waterproof after 24 hours.
It's important to be sure that your dog doesn't have any issues before you apply it. Dogs with compromised immune systems, severe allergies to just about everything, or similar conditions probably should not have any type of spot treatment applied, but if your guy or gal is healthy, then it should work for you.
If your main problem is fleas, there may be a better product and a better way to attack the problem. I'd check with your vet for that.
